Case Western Reserve University (CWRU) vs. Villanova University

Compare two schools with tuition, admission, test scores, and more academic characteristics.

  • Both Case Western Reserve University (CWRU) and Villanova University are private.
  • CWRU is located in Cleveland, OH and Villanova University is located in Villanova, PA.
  • Villanova University has more expensive tuition of $64,701 than CWRU ($64,671).
  • CWRU has tighter acceptance rate of 33.12% than Villanova University (36.00%).
  • CWRU has higher SAT scores of 1,490 than Villanova University (1,440).
  • CWRU is larger with 12,201 students than Villanova University (10,383 students).
